“…Yongli Xu et al [21] performed a systematic global optical model description for 6 Li projectiles scattered elastically from targets ranging from 24 Mg to 209 Bi at energies below 250 MeV. The obtained global optical potential from this study was found to be applicable for different elastic scattering processes induced by 6 Li.…”

“…The data at high energies [8][9][10][11][12][13][14] were also subjected to various optical model (OM) and DF analysis. The 6 Li + 28 Si system has been subjected to several theoretical studies [15][16][17][18][19][20][21] recently, which were devoted to investigating this nuclear system either at low and high energies using different pure OM and DF potentials. M. Anwar [17] analyzed the experimental angular distributions of 6 Li scattered elastically by different targets − 24 Mg, 28 Si, 40 Ca, 48 Ca, 58 Ni, 90 Zr, and 11 6Sn -at E lab ( 6 Li) = 240 MeV.…”
